Output ad70e3fd0e808189918cd3f25c6d3e33c79b6d65c596ad368a1edc6c57d35d50:1

value
666415187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0018d0e770c95a817d9405bca9a409f47e7bbb3f OP_EQUAL
address
31hXent3EhW9PrfQQ5P5JTaA7XWtPTBtAT
transaction
ad70e3fd0e808189918cd3f25c6d3e33c79b6d65c596ad368a1edc6c57d35d50
spent
true